Commentary for “Sum Quod Sum, Part 2″

Let me start out by saying that I tried to like this week’s graphic novel. I kept telling myself, that it would get back to the “feel” of last week’s. To that end, I will start with the positives:

1) I positively loved Jason Badower’s artwork (and not just because he added me as a friend on facebook and actually exchanged friendly emails with me). Elle gets sexier every time he draws her and I am almost certain she isn’t eating because she seems to have lost all of her baby fat. Further, Jason really captures the effect Elle’s power has when she is not in control. The GN and the show both were able to mimic each other. Sometimes show effects don’t translate well to GN’s.

2) I enjoyed the continued saga of Elle having no control of her powers. Other than the guy who could melt pots, she is really the first “Hero” who is completely out of control.

3) The comic gives us a very direct insight into the reason for Elle’s lack of control which, if nothing else, is very plausible. Her father had always controlled her life and now that he is gone, she has no controls and that scares her. I believe that could lead to no control over her powers especially when surprised, scared, etc. (Can’t wait until she meets Knox and he gets stronger with her fear but then she sends another desperation blast). I also get the idea that not only is she afraid of being alone but she is worried that someone might be coming after her.

4) I am absolutely happy (especially since Tarot won’t be in mourning….for now) that they found a way for Elle to look elsewhere for help without killing Claude.
